
Uncovering the Wonder: Why Cabinets of Curiosities Are Captivating Collectors Again
There was a time when collectors really did not just get to have-- they curated their collections as tales. Long before minimalist insides and electronic galleries, the "closet of curiosities" was the supreme expression of inquisitiveness, preference, and intelligence. Likewise referred to as wunderkammern, these closets were much less regarding storage and even more about phenomenon-- ornate display screens loaded with uncommon minerals, maintained bugs, tribal artefacts, clinical wonders, and imaginative prizes. They were a declaration of knowledge and marvel.
Fast-forward to today, and something fascinating is occurring. The closet of curiosities is making a silent yet striking resurgence. In an age filled with electronic material, there's a growing hunger for the substantial, the special, and the storied. Modern enthusiasts are restoring the spirit of these cabinets-- not simply in the actual sense but in how they come close to gathering: with thoughtfulness, intentionality, and an interest for the unusual.

Mixing the Past and Present: How Old Meets New in Collecting
Among the most amazing facets of this rebirth is just how it combines the vintage with the new. Where typical cabinets were full of natural wonders and exotic oddities, contemporary analyses typically blend historic artefacts with modern pieces. You might locate a 19th-century dispenser bottle alongside a contemporary abstract sculpture. Or an old coin displayed close to a vintage electronic camera.
This mix offers a layered feeling of time. It creates contrast and deepness-- something contemporary insides usually do not have. It likewise reflects the collector's journey, their curiosity stretching throughout eras and styles. And with the help of an advancing market, sourcing such pieces has never been much easier.
